When copying a file I get the following message:
The file "FILENAME" cannot be copied or moved without losing its encryption.
You can choose to ignore this error and continue, or cancel.
This ONLY happens when I copy to a company server. I built an estimating tool that many people will use locally then transfer it to the server. I am worried this error message will cause havoc.
Any ideas on this? Could it be a virus scan on the company servers?
The file is not password protected. The only passwords in it are for individual sheet protections.
I created a test file with sheets protected and copied it to the company server. It had no problems.
I created a test file with password protection upon open and it had no problems.
It must be something in the excel tool I created. Any ideas?
